Virtual Vegas, Real Danger: Protecting Yourself From Casino Scams
The allure of instant riches and the thrill of the game can be intoxicating. But in the expansive world of virtual casinos, danger lurks around every corner. Scammers are constantly on the prowl, willing to cheat unsuspecting players out of their hard-earned money. It's crucial to be aware of the risks and take steps to preserve yourself from falling victim to these deceptive schemes.
- Practice caution when picking an online casino. Look into its standing.
- Ensure the casino is licensed by a respected authority.
- Read the agreement carefully before funding any money.
Never share your banking information to anyone unverified. Be vigilant and report any doubtful activity to the platform authorities. Remember, when it comes to digital casinos, safety should always be your top concern.
